Fire outbreak at Lagos airport

A fire incident was reported on Sunday, August 2, at Terminal 2 of the Murtala Muhammed International Airport (MMIA) in Lagos, prompting an emergency response by aviation authorities.

The Federal Airports Authority of Nigeria (FAAN) confirmed the development in a statement, adding that its Aerodrome Rescue and Firefighting Service (ARFFS) was immediately mobilised to the scene to contain the outbreak and prevent it from spreading.

According to the authority, emergency personnel were actively battling the fire and working to ensure the safety of airport users and facilities within the terminal area.

FAAN assured the public that no deaths or injuries had been recorded as of the time of the announcement.

The Murtala Muhammed International Airport is Nigeria’s busiest aviation hub, handling thousands of domestic and international passengers daily.
